From 9875ba156e097fdbd40879f195ffddd0740fc4b4 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Andreas Reinhold / reini Date: Mon, 14 Sep 2026 06:14:34 +0200 Subject: [PATCH] Put the carousel's tab stop on its items, as M3 asks Plan step 19, containment.md C-18. The row was the focusable `region` and the items were not focusable at all, which is the thing M3's accessibility page draws a Don't for: "use Tab to place initial focus on the first carousel item", "avoid focusing on the carousel container". Each item is now `tabindex="0"` with the focus ring drawn inside it, the row is out of the tab order, and from a focused item the arrows move one item (moving focus with them), Home and End go to the ends, and Space or Enter opens one that is not fully in view.
